About CYP2D7

Summary

This gene is a member of the Cytochrome P450 gene superfamily. The Cytochrome P450 proteins are monooxygenases which catalyze many reactions involved in drug metabolism and synthesis of Cholesterol, Steroids and Other lipids. This gene is a segregating pseudogene, where some individuals may have an allele that encodes a functional Enzyme, while Other individuals have an allele encoding a protein that is predicted to be non-functional. In this case, the functional allele is thought to be rare. This locus is part of a cluster of Cytochrome P450 genes on chromosome 22. [provided by RefSeq, Jan 2017]
